Package net.schmizz.sshj.signature
Class AbstractSignature
- java.lang.Object
-
- net.schmizz.sshj.signature.AbstractSignature
-
- All Implemented Interfaces:
Signature
- Direct Known Subclasses:
AbstractSignatureDSA,SignatureEdDSA,SignatureRSA
public abstract class AbstractSignature extends java.lang.Object implements Signature
An abstract class forSignaturethat implements common functionality.

Method Detail
-
getSignatureName
public java.lang.String getSignatureName()
- Specified by:
getSignatureNamein interfaceSignature
-
initVerify
public void initVerify(java.security.PublicKey publicKey)
Description copied from interface:SignatureInitialize this signature with the given public key for signature verification. Note that subsequent calls to eitherSignature.initVerify(PublicKey)orSignature.initSign(PrivateKey)will overwrite prior initialization.- Specified by:
initVerifyin interfaceSignature- Parameters:
publicKey- the public key to use for signature verification
-
initSign
public void initSign(java.security.PrivateKey privateKey)
Description copied from interface:SignatureInitialize this signature with the given private key for signing. Note that subsequent calls to eitherSignature.initVerify(PublicKey)orSignature.initSign(PrivateKey)will overwrite prior initialization.
